    The fast Fourier transform (FFT) represents one of the most important advancements in scientific and engineering computing of the last century. Until now, however, treatments of algorithmic aspects of FFT have been either brief, cryptic, intimidating, or not published in the open literature. Inside the FFT Black Box takes a unified and systematic approach that brings the numerous and varied ideas together into a common notational framework. It bridges the gap between textbooks and the literature on serial and parallel FFT algorithms and provides a modern, self-contained guide for learning the FFT and the multitude of ideas and computing techniques it employs.

    Whether you're encrypting or decrypting ciphers, a solid background in number theory is essential for success. This book takes you from basic number theory to the inner workings of ciphers and protocols. It builds a foundation in number theory and shows you how to apply it when breaking ciphers and when designing ones that are difficult to break.
